0

次の簡単なコードで問題が発生しています

BindingList<Car> tempList = new BindingList<Car>();
BindingSource bindingSource = new BindingSource();
bindingSource.DataSource = tempList;
dgTempView.DataSource = bindingSource;

ここで、dgTempViewはデータグリッドビューです。上記の行が実行された後、データグリッドビューの列数は0のままです。tempListにCarインスタンスを追加しようとすると、「データグリッドビューに行を追加できません」というエラーが表示されます。列を持たないコントロール'。ここで何が欠けているのか理解できません

4

1 に答える 1

0

私の間違いを見つけました。クラスカーのメンバーはパブリックインスタンス変数であり、プロパティではありませんでした。それらを自動プロパティに変更した瞬間、それは機能しました:)

于 2012-06-04T10:51:28.047 に答える